Gentoo Archives: gentoo-commits

From: Matthias Maier <tamiko@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: app-doc/doxygen/
Date: Wed, 11 Mar 2020 14:42:50
Message-Id: 1583937755.90be434a198cfa99980002c711dc8beab65216c8.tamiko@gentoo
1 commit: 90be434a198cfa99980002c711dc8beab65216c8
2 Author: Matthias Maier <tamiko <AT> gentoo <DOT> org>
3 AuthorDate: Wed Mar 11 14:07:35 2020 +0000
4 Commit: Matthias Maier <tamiko <AT> gentoo <DOT> org>
5 CommitDate: Wed Mar 11 14:42:35 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=90be434a
7
8 app-doc/doxygen: restrict to <sys-devel/clang-10
9
10 Closes: https://bugs.gentoo.org/711650
11 Package-Manager: Portage-2.3.93, Repoman-2.3.20
12 Signed-off-by: Matthias Maier <tamiko <AT> gentoo.org>
13
14 app-doc/doxygen/doxygen-1.8.15.ebuild | 7 +++++--
15 app-doc/doxygen/doxygen-1.8.16-r1.ebuild | 6 ++++--
16 app-doc/doxygen/doxygen-1.8.17.ebuild | 7 +++++--
17 3 files changed, 14 insertions(+), 6 deletions(-)
18
19 diff --git a/app-doc/doxygen/doxygen-1.8.15.ebuild b/app-doc/doxygen/doxygen-1.8.15.ebuild
20 index 494edad1726..f9f0496eaf8 100644
21 --- a/app-doc/doxygen/doxygen-1.8.15.ebuild
22 +++ b/app-doc/doxygen/doxygen-1.8.15.ebuild
23 @@ -6,7 +6,7 @@ PYTHON_COMPAT=( python3_6 )
24
25 CMAKE_MAKEFILE_GENERATOR="emake"
26
27 -inherit cmake-utils eutils python-any-r1
28 +inherit cmake-utils eutils llvm python-any-r1
29 if [[ ${PV} = *9999* ]]; then
30 inherit git-r3
31 EGIT_REPO_URI="https://github.com/doxygen/doxygen.git"
32 @@ -27,7 +27,7 @@ RDEPEND="app-text/ghostscript-gpl
33 dev-lang/perl
34 media-libs/libpng:0=
35 virtual/libiconv
36 - clang? ( >=sys-devel/clang-4.0.0:= )
37 + clang? ( <sys-devel/clang-10:= )
38 dot? (
39 media-gfx/graphviz
40 media-libs/freetype
41 @@ -67,7 +67,10 @@ PATCHES=(
42
43 DOCS=( LANGUAGE.HOWTO README.md )
44
45 +LLVM_MAX_SLOT=9
46 +
47 pkg_setup() {
48 + use clang && llvm_pkg_setup
49 use doc && python-any-r1_pkg_setup
50 }
51
52
53 diff --git a/app-doc/doxygen/doxygen-1.8.16-r1.ebuild b/app-doc/doxygen/doxygen-1.8.16-r1.ebuild
54 index e3fc34ade51..c3de40c09ae 100644
55 --- a/app-doc/doxygen/doxygen-1.8.16-r1.ebuild
56 +++ b/app-doc/doxygen/doxygen-1.8.16-r1.ebuild
57 @@ -6,7 +6,7 @@ PYTHON_COMPAT=( python3_6 )
58
59 CMAKE_MAKEFILE_GENERATOR="emake"
60
61 -inherit cmake-utils eutils python-any-r1
62 +inherit cmake-utils eutils llvm python-any-r1
63 if [[ ${PV} = *9999* ]]; then
64 inherit git-r3
65 EGIT_REPO_URI="https://github.com/doxygen/doxygen.git"
66 @@ -28,7 +28,7 @@ RDEPEND="app-text/ghostscript-gpl
67 dev-lang/perl
68 media-libs/libpng:0=
69 virtual/libiconv
70 - clang? ( >=sys-devel/clang-4.0.0:= )
71 + clang? ( <sys-devel/clang-10:= )
72 dot? (
73 media-gfx/graphviz
74 media-libs/freetype
75 @@ -68,8 +68,10 @@ PATCHES=(
76 )
77
78 DOCS=( LANGUAGE.HOWTO README.md )
79 +LLVM_MAX_SLOT=9
80
81 pkg_setup() {
82 + use clang && llvm_pkg_setup
83 use doc && python-any-r1_pkg_setup
84 }
85
86
87 diff --git a/app-doc/doxygen/doxygen-1.8.17.ebuild b/app-doc/doxygen/doxygen-1.8.17.ebuild
88 index f850b147329..da2248eb1e4 100644
89 --- a/app-doc/doxygen/doxygen-1.8.17.ebuild
90 +++ b/app-doc/doxygen/doxygen-1.8.17.ebuild
91 @@ -6,7 +6,7 @@ PYTHON_COMPAT=( python3_{6,7,8} )
92
93 CMAKE_MAKEFILE_GENERATOR="emake"
94
95 -inherit cmake-utils eutils python-any-r1
96 +inherit cmake-utils eutils llvm python-any-r1
97 if [[ ${PV} = *9999* ]]; then
98 inherit git-r3
99 EGIT_REPO_URI="https://github.com/doxygen/doxygen.git"
100 @@ -28,7 +28,7 @@ RDEPEND="app-text/ghostscript-gpl
101 dev-lang/perl
102 media-libs/libpng:0=
103 virtual/libiconv
104 - clang? ( >=sys-devel/clang-4.0.0:= )
105 + clang? ( <sys-devel/clang-10:= )
106 dot? (
107 media-gfx/graphviz
108 media-libs/freetype
109 @@ -66,7 +66,10 @@ PATCHES=(
110
111 DOCS=( LANGUAGE.HOWTO README.md )
112
113 +LLVM_MAX_SLOT=9
114 +
115 pkg_setup() {
116 + use clang && llvm_pkg_setup
117 use doc && python-any-r1_pkg_setup
118 }